how do you say “swing “ in spanish?

Hello again! It depends if you're using "swing" as a verb or as a noun. If it's the former, you would say "columpiarse" or "balancearse". Be aware that this is a "self fulfilling action" in Castillian, so you would have to conjugate it with the pronouns (yo me columpio/ balanceo, tu te columpias/balanceas, el se columpia/ balancea...). If the action is made by you to another person you wouldn't need the pronouns (yo columpio a..., tu columpias a..., él columpia a...).
If you mean "swing" as a noun (where the children play in a park) it would be "columpio". Hope this helps!

Hola, In Spanish usually the "swing" where the kids play is called "columpio" and "to swing" is "columpiarse".

In addition to Clara, you can use also "swing" as such if you are talking about this movement in sports, as golf or baseball or tennis. "Tiene buen swing", for example. It´s included as word in the dictionary of Real Academia Española.
